Explanation: Passing is a sociological term used to describe persons who present themselves as different from their original tribe or racial category.
People who engage in this type of act are mainly those of minority groups and racial category who feel or believe that by disclosing and identifying with their original tribe or racial category it will lead to discrimination,some also believe that by not identifying with their racial category they will be protected and they will enjoy certain benefits from the tribe or racial category they have identified with.

Color vision deficiency is the lack of ability to differentiate certain shades of color. The term "color blindness" can also be used to explain this visual challenge, but a very small number of people are entirely color blind.
Color vision deficiency can range from a mild condition to a severe case, depending on the cause. It can even affect both eyes if it is hereditary and generally just one if it is caused by illness or injury.
This condition is likely due to photoreceptors in the retina of the eye identified as cones. These cones have a light-sensitive pigment that allows us to identify different colors.
